Web5 May 2024 · Humayun’s Return from Exile After Sher Shah’s death in 1545, his weak successors ruled for ten years. Humayun, who had fled after his defeat at Kanauj, had taken asylum in Persia. Humayun then went to Afghanistan with Persian troops. He succeeded in capturing Kandahar and Kabul. Web9 Jun 2024 · The Story of Maharani Karnavati and the Mughal Emperor Humayun The second jauhar in 1535 was result of an unexpected onslaught by Sultan Bahadur Shah of Gujarat. Maharani Karnavati, the dowager queen of Maharana Sanga, was ruling Mewar on behalf of her son Vikramaditya.
